'SNL' Star Cecily Strong Not 'Angry or Sad' for Being Replaced on 'Weekend Update'
TV

The former 'Weekend Update' co-anchor says she's 'genuinely happy' that Michael Che replaces her in the segment.

AceShowbiz - Cecily Strong has spoken up after she was cut from "Weekend Update" on "Saturday Night Live". The comedian, who remains a cast member on the show, took to Instagram on Friday night, September 12 to assure fans that there's no bad blood after she was replaced by Michael Che as "Weekend Update" co-anchor.

"I don't see this as me leaving update, just as me being on update in a looser, goofier way that is a lot more fun for me and in a way I think I'm better at," she wrote. "And now I get to do features with the very funny and wonderful Michael Che! No point in being angry or sad for me for something I'm genuinely happy about!"

Che, who has been a correspondent for "The Daily Show with Jon Stewart" and a writer on "SNL", will make his debut as the new "Weekend Update" co-anchor when the NBC series kicks off its 40th season on September 27. He joins Colin Jost in the segment.

Chris Pratt will host the season opener with musical guest Ariana Grande.
